An April 3 bid by Canada-based global design giant SNC-Lavalin to buy U.K. engineer Atkins, valued at $2.6 billion, has been confirmed by both firms’ boards and further indicates a resurgence in industry sector consolidation, observers say.

Shares of Australia-based WorleyParsons rose 32% on Feb. 28, following the firm’s disclosure the day before that, last November, Dubai-based engineer conglomerate Dar Group had made an estimated $2.2- billion bid, which it rejected as undervalued.
